Joe R. Frye, 77, of Magnet Cove passed away on Sunday, May 7, 2023 at National Park Medical Center. He was born January 1, 1946, in Oklahoma City, OK the son of the late, Raymond Otis and Juanita Maxine Tolland Frye. Joe served in the United States Navy during the Vietnam War. He worked at Reynolds Rolling Mill in the maintenanc­e department for many years. He was a member of Butterfiel­d Missionary Baptist Church. Joe enjoyed golfing, hunting, fishing, was an avid Dallas Cowboy fan and loved making cathead biscuits.
